🚙 Stops featured in this 360 video:
Pahonu Hill – Take in breathtaking panoramic views of Matira Beach and Bora Bora’s turquoise harbor from this elevated lookout.
WWII Cannons – Ride along the rugged coastal hills to explore giant coastal defense guns left behind by the U.S. military in WWII.
Fa’anui Valley & Marae Temples – Discover lush jungle trails, sacred stone temples, and gaze down on the surreal blues of Fa’anui Bay from a mountain-side plantation.
